private void SelectFile_Click(object sender, RoutedEventArgs e) { ParcerDataTable = new ParcerDataTable(); if (ParcerDataTable.GetResultOpenFileDialog() == true) { TextBoxNotFoundFile.Text = "Файл выбран"; } else { TextBoxNotFoundFile.Text = "Файл не выбран"; } }
private void OpenConfiguration(object sender, RoutedEventArgs e) { Microsoft.Win32.OpenFileDialog fileDialog = new Microsoft.Win32.OpenFileDialog(); fileDialog.Filter = "Файлы txt|*.txt"; if (fileDialog.ShowDialog() == true) { string Path = fileDialog.FileName; try { using (StreamReader sr = new StreamReader(Path, System.Text.Encoding.Default)) { ParcerDataTable = new ParcerDataTable(sr.ReadLine()); //путь к xlsx Checked_name_column_value.Text = sr.ReadLine(); Checked_name_column_time.Text = sr.ReadLine(); Checked_number_list.Text = sr.ReadLine(); Checked_number_line_start_information.Text = sr.ReadLine(); Checked_number_line_end_information.Text = sr.ReadLine(); Checked_color_series.Text = sr.ReadLine(); NameSeries.Text = sr.ReadLine(); if (sr.ReadLine() == "true") { Checked_flag_simplified_date.IsChecked = true; } else { Checked_flag_simplified_date.IsChecked = false; } TextBoxNotFoundFile.Text = "Файл выбран"; } } catch { TextBoxNotFoundFile.Text = "Файл не выбран"; WindowError windowError = new WindowError("Не удалось прочитать файл"); windowError.Show(); return; } } }